One of the biggest takeaways from today's shoot was the sheer practicality involved. You need a perfect location – a Porsche Performance shop offers both prestige and the right environment for dynamic shots, allowing the cars to truly shine. Then there's the equipment: drones for breathtaking aerials, specialized rigs for tracking shots, and top-of-the-line cameras to capture every gleam and curve. But more than just gear, it's the eye for detail. Thinking about the angles, the lighting, and how to make each car pop on screen is crucial. For anyone dreaming of getting into car videography, my biggest advice is just to start. You don't need a Porsche shop on day one! Begin with what you have, even your phone, and focus on learning the craft. Understand composition, master basic editing, and most importantly, find your unique voice. Watch how creators like Halle Simons present their content, analyze what makes it compelling, and then experiment. What stories do you want to tell about cars? Collaboration is also key; working with other enthusiasts or even small local car clubs can open up incredible opportunities.
